Full Description
How is Prince William descended from Dracula? Do we all come from Africa? Were some of our ancestors really only three feet tall? This book, teeming with fascinating facts, history, photos and activities will inspire children to dig out their family records to discover their own ancestors and family connections. Using step-by-step activities, readers will be able to trace their histories through existing family records and interviews with members of the family. By the end of the book, children will have created their very own extended family tree, will have understood why we have surnames and how Genghis Khan is related to the British Royal Family.
